Kevin Sacre, who plays Jake Dean, is quitting Hollyoaks after six years on the Channel 4 show.

Jake has been part of some the show’s most shocking plots, but is set to leave our screens next month in one of the most explosive storylines yet.
In previous months, we have watched in anticipation as Jake attacked Nancy, tried to kill baby Charlie and was then locked up as his mental health deteriorated. Now he is back and is in for more bad luck when he is accused of Shaun’s murder.
Sacre, who has been with the soap since 2002, said:
‘I'd love to go and do something and people say 'oh look there's Kev, he's doing well and he's one of our lot.’
Sacre filmed his final scenes at Lime Pictures, home of Hollyoaks, last week and will remain on our screens until May. So be sure to get your Jake-fix in quick – sob!
